Highlights
Are people in Stover older or younger than people in Paris?
- The Median Age in Stover is 4.5 years older than in Paris.

Are housing costs cheaper in Stover or Paris?
- Stover housing costs are 36.9% more expensive than Paris hous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Stover or Paris?
- The average commute for residents of Stover is 1.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Paris.
